At Brighouse High School our aim is to create a culture where attendance and punctuality matters so our students can access our curriculum and fulfil their potential. We are committed to meeting our obligations with regards to school attendance by promoting good attendance and reducing absences. We will support parents/carers to enable our students to have access to the full-time education to which they are entitled and avoid any unnecessary absences.
Students with no absences are twice as likely to achieve 5 or more GCSEs at Grade 5+ including English and Mathematics, than those with an attendance of 90% or below. Students who are 15 minutes late to school each day will have missed 2 weeks of school in a one year period.
